Discover the Charm of Washington

Washington is not just known for its scenic parks and green spaces, such as the beautiful Washington Wetland Centre, but also for its commitment to education and the arts. The area is steeped in history, with landmarks like the Washington Old Hall, which was once the ancestral home of George Washington's family. This historic site serves as a reminder of the town's cultural significance and its links to American history, enriching the context of any literature studies.
